
Atmus Filtration Technologies Completes Acquisition of Koch Filter Corporation
Atmus Filtration Technologies Inc. a global leader in filtration and media solutions, today announced that it has closed its acquisition of Koch Filter Corporation (“Koch Filter”) from Air Distribution Technologies, Inc. (“ADTi”), a portfolio company of Truelink Capital, for a total cash consideration of approximately $450 million, subject to customary purchase price adjustments.
The completion of the Koch Filter acquisition establishes Atmus’ industrial air filtration platform and expands its portfolio into high-growth end-markets, including commercial and industrial HVAC, data centers and power generation markets.
We are excited to welcome the Koch Filter team to Atmus. Together, we are committed to unlocking our growth potential and executing our strategy of expanding into industrial filtration markets,” said Steph Disher, Chief Executive Officer of Atmus.
The acquisition establishes the Company’s new Industrial Solutions segment. The Koch Filter business will report into that segment and be led by Rakesh Gangwani, Senior Vice President, Strategy and President, Industrial Solutions. Mark Mattingly, Koch Filter’s president, who has deep industry experience established over three decades, will continue to lead the Koch Filter business, reporting to Rakesh Gangwani.
Simultaneously with the closing of the transaction, Atmus entered an amended and restated five-year $1.5 billion credit facility, consisting of a $500 million revolving credit facility and a $1 billion term loan.
As previously disclosed, the acquisition of Koch Filter is expected to be accretive to Atmus’ Adjusted EPS and Adjusted EBITDA margin in 2026 and achieve high-single-digit ROIC by 2028. The transaction was funded through a combination of cash on hand and borrowings under the Company’s amended and restated credit facility.
About Atmus Filtration Technologies Inc.
Atmus Filtration Technologies Inc. is a global leader in filtration and media solutions. For more than 65 years, the company has combined its culture of innovation with a rich history of designing and manufacturing filtration solutions. With a global presence spanning six continents, Atmus serves customers across truck, bus, agriculture, construction, mining, marine and power generation vehicle and equipment markets, along with providing comprehensive aftermarket support and solutions. Headquartered in Nashville, Tennessee (U.S.), Atmus employs approximately 4,500 people globally who are committed to creating a better future by protecting what is important.
